SECRETARY
AND RECORDS
While this program does not
report to a National-level department, the Secretary / Records (SR) exercises
responsibility and supervision for the recording and subsequent publication
of the minutes of official sessions, as well as ensure unit record retention
requirements are met.

General
SR Duties
- Maintain close liaison with
the next highest Secretary/Records Staff Officer.
- Be responsible for the recording
and publication of the minutes of the unit when it meets in official
sessions.
- Maintain a current record
of unit officers, committee assignments and such other appointments.
- Maintain such other records
as may be required to ensure the correctness and continuity of administration.
- Assume staff responsibility
for matters pertaining to administrative and personnel reporting.
- Maintain a current roster
of unit members.
- Maintain a copy of the unit
Standing Rules and other records as may be required to ensure the correctness
and continuity of administration.
- Report monthly to the Vice
about the activities and progress in carrying out these duties.
- Prepare an agenda for each
unit meeting.
- Publish the unit meeting
notice, with meeting agenda, to all categories of attendees.
- Create and maintain a unit
binder for all unit documentation. May be electronic or hard copy.
- At each unit meeting, present
the minutes of the previous meeting for approval.
- Once approved ensure minutes
are signed (wet or electronically)
- Ensure all meeting attendees
and guests sign in.
2008 CHANGES
- Separate 7017 is no longer
required
- All unit must submit their
minutes via the "Record of Meeting" template
- Paper minutes, 7017 or record
of meeting will no longer be accepted
- All "Record of Meeting"
must be submitted electronically via the District Document Control
Center
- Once submitted the "Record
of Meeting" will be retrievable, searchable and viewable via the District
Document Control Center
